Output 75d7888a81687f6f9e888975c07247261f3761dc12fc20456060c84f3543307a:20

value
686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b89fbbd9277391070c6e35cefb8d31cbbaf1409b0d57c61b4ab945c3f277d10c
address
bc1phz0mhkf8wwgswrrwxh80hrf3ewa0zsymp4tuvx62h9zu8unh6yxqx0vf7e
transaction
75d7888a81687f6f9e888975c07247261f3761dc12fc20456060c84f3543307a
spent
true